Recall 208699
USA Recall: Improperly heat-treated engine rails may reduce the vehicle's structural protection in a crash, increasing the risk of injury. in addition, an engine rail may detach and contact the road while driving, increasing the risk of a crash.
Ford motor company (ford) is recalling certain 2022 lincoln aviator and ford explorer vehicles. the engine rails may have been improperly heat-treated. as such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of federal motor vehicle safety standard numbers 208, "occupant crash protection" and 301, "fuel system integrity."
Corrective Action:
Dealers will perform an engine rail strength test and replace the rails as necessary, free of charge. if the engine rails require replacement, owners will have the option for a vehicle replacement or buyback. owner notification letters were mailed august 22, 2022. owners may contact 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. ford's number for this recall is 22c13.
